Introduction to Dark Electro-Pop Music: Definition, History, and Origins
Dark Electro-Pop is a subgenre of electronic music that blends the synthetic, rhythm-driven characteristics of electro-pop with darker, more atmospheric elements. Originating in the early 2000s, this genre often incorporates elements from industrial, synthwave, darkwave, and EBM (electronic body music) to create a haunting, brooding atmosphere. The genre is known for its use of deep, melancholic vocals, synthetic melodies, and dystopian soundscapes. It emerged as an underground movement, gaining prominence in the European and North American music scenes. Early influences include pioneers of industrial and synth music, such as Front 242 and Depeche Mode, who provided the foundation for the merging of electronic pop with darker, more introspective tones.
Sub-tags and Classifications of Dark Electro-Pop
Gothic Electro-Pop
Gothic Electro-Pop merges dark, melancholic elements of gothic rock with the rhythmic and melodic features of electro-pop. TheDark Electro-Pop content use of atmospheric synths, reverb-laden vocals, and eerie tones are central to its sound, often addressing themes of romance, despair, and existential dread.
Industrial Electro-Pop
Industrial Electro-Pop integrates the abrasive, mechanized sound of industrial music with catchy, danceable electro-pop melodies. It often features distorted vocals, aggressive beats, and themes of alienation, societal decay, and dystopia.
Synthwave Electro-Pop
Synthwave Electro-Pop combines the retro, nostalgic elements of 1980s synthwave with the modern, darker side of electro-pop. Characterized by shimmering synths, punchy basslines, and futuristic soundscapes, this sub-genre evokes a sense of dystopian futurism.
Darkwave Electro-Pop
Darkwave Electro-Pop leans heavily on atmospheric sound design and melancholic vocals. It emphasizes emotional depth, often dealing with introspective themes and blending the moody, somber characteristics of darkwave with the catchy rhythms and structures of electro-pop.
Famous Artists and Iconic Works in Dark Electro-Pop
Crystal Castles
Crystal Castles is a groundbreaking duo known for their abrasive, experimental approach to Dark Electro-Pop. Their music blends harsh, industrial soundscapes with ethereal, haunting vocals, creating a unique blend of aggressive energy and introspective melancholia. Their albums 'Crystal Castles' and 'II' are iconic, featuring tracks that have shaped the genre.
Crystal Castles - 'Not In Love'
One of Crystal Castles' most iconic tracks, 'Not In Love' features a haunting combination of icy, distorted synths and ethereal vocals. The song’s minimalist, yet emotionally powerful, composition captures the essence of Dark Electro-Pop, blending industrial aggression with dreamy, melancholic pop.
Zola Jesus
Zola Jesus, with her powerful mezzo-soprano voice, fuses gothic electro-pop with industrial and darkwave elements. Her album 'Conatus' features a mix of haunting, atmospheric production and emotionally charged lyrics, establishing her as a leading figure in the genre.
Zola Jesus - 'Night'
Zola Jesus’ 'Night' from the album 'Conatus' is a standout example of Dark Electro-Pop, with its rich atmospheric production and emotionally charged lyrics. The track fuses cold, electronic beats with an industrial edge and Nika Roza Danilova’s haunting vocals, creating a palpable sense of melancholy and isolation.
Grimes
Grimes is an artist known for blending electronic music with avant-garde pop and elements of Dark Electro-Pop. Her album 'Visions' combines eerie, distorted sounds with catchy, haunting pop melodies, showcasing a futuristic and otherworldly take on the genre.
Grimes - 'Oblivion'
Grimes’ 'Oblivion' from the album 'Visions' merges experimental electro-pop with darker, introspective elements. Its catchy yet eerie melody, paired with lyrics about vulnerability and fear, exemplifies Grimes’ ability to blend accessibility with the more enigmatic tones of Dark Electro-Pop.
Soman
Soman is a key artist in the industrial electro-pop scene. Known for their driving, intense beats and dark, aggressive vocals, they have contributed a series of classic albums such as 'Paleothought' and 'Maschinen' that continue to influence the dark electro-pop movement.
Soman - 'Paleothought'
Soman’s 'Paleothought' from the album of the same name is a defining track in the industrial electro-pop sub-genre. With aggressive beats, distorted vocals, and intense production, the track captures the genre's raw energy and deep, introspective undertones.
Application Scenarios for Dark Electro-Pop Music
Dark Electro-Pop is frequently used in movie soundtracks, particularly in genres such as science fiction, thriller, and horror. Its moody and atmospheric qualities can help build tension, evoke dystopian or apocalyptic themes, and enhance scenes with a futuristic or otherworldly feel. Movies like 'Blade Runner 2049' and 'The Neon Demon' use similar dark electronic styles to enhance their cinematic atmosphere.
